This paper addresses the need for better information access to digital library collections. Without proper visualization tools, organizational and structural information is often lost or suppressed by digital library interfaces. We discuss a 2D fractal tree visualization tool that can be used to more accurately present the structure, organization and interrelation of collection metadata.
